Significant progress will be seen on the Cancer Survivors Park in the coming days as the Heirloom Companies begins installation of the Celebration Pavilion in downtown Greenville.

The structure’s materials were imported from Canada to Chicago, Ill., where The Heirloom Companies’ team flew up to prepare and bend the materials. Heirloom rolled the individual ribs of the canopy structure using the only machine fit for the project available in the country, according to a press release from the Heirloom Companies.

The structure is crafted from mild steel and measures 55ft x 40ft x 50ft.

Cancer Survivors Park is located next to the Chamber of Commerce at 24 Cleveland St.

This is phase II for the Cancer Survivors Park, a 6.8 acre site along the Swamp Rabbit Trail. It addition to the Pavilion centerpiece, it includes a bridge that crosses the river, a waterfall, an ADA-accessible garden and walkway, and a survivorship education center.

The Cancer Survivors Park Alliance is the force behind the park, which will be turned over to the city of Greenville when completed.
